I FIND it an extreme convenience to do my stuff online, but a government app I tried to use recently asked me to visit the relevant offices. I found that funny. What is the point ofhaving an appifit tells people to physically visit the offices? Such a regressive attitude only sparks economic and environmental costs in surprising ways. We have created demand for petrol and its logistics, foreign exchange, road expansions, traffic congestion, air pollution, parking issues, office infrastructure and electricity, clerical staff, paper and pens,technicalsupportfor outdated systems, security personnel, audits, stress management therapists, and even healthcare for pollution-induced illnesses. All this simply because thegovernment wants people to visit the offices.

This is a story of utter governance inefficiency. Every extra mile driven, paper wasted, and hour spent in frustration contributes to a much grander narrative.
